Burnham 1st XI 144-3 beat Street 2nd XI 143-6 by 7 wkts

BURNHAM triumphed fairly comfortably in a match reduced to 40 overs a side because of a downpour just before the scheduled start time.

Batting first, Street got off to a shocker, losing their opener for one thanks to a superb diving catch from Phil White. Western (24) and W. Wall (28) then attempted to rebuild the innings, taking the score to 40 in the 12th over. However, Stuart Green put paid to the recovery, taking three wickets in quick succession, which left Street precariously placed at 71-4.

Following his removal from the attack, Hamlett and D. Wall constructed a 61-run partnership, although Darren Aston and Andy Smith were far from expensive, restricting Street to fewer than four runs per over. And the crucial breakthrough came at 132, when Aston bowled Hamlett for 32, with Farrow soon following after being caught off Aston for three in the last over.

In reply, Burnham got off to a slow start, with a spell of 29 consecutive dot balls hampering their progress. Jim Bloodworth was dropped on zero, which proved to be a very costly miss because, despite losing opening partner Brad House for ten, he soon found his rhythm and turned the tide irreversibly in Burnham’s favour with help from Robbie Driver.

Bloodworth reached his 50 off 73 balls, in spite of the slow outfield, which meant he scored just three boundaries. Having played a vital supporting role, Driver (26) was dismissed at 104 but, by then, victory was in sight. Bloodworth was caught off Vowles for an impressive 71 but Julian Stearnes (11 no) and Pete Harris (12 no) kept their nerve to wrap up the victory.
